Legal secretaries are in high demand in Colorado Springs. These professionals are responsible for organizing legal documents, scheduling court appearances, and providing administrative support to attorneys. If you’re looking for an entry-level position in the law field, this is a great option. Paralegals are also in demand in Colorado Springs. Paralegals do a lot of the same work that attorneys do, such as researching legal issues, drafting legal documents, and preparing for trials. They’re particularly useful in helping attorneys prepare for cases. Attorneys are also needed in Colorado Springs. Attorneys are responsible for representing clients in court, negotiating settlements, and providing legal advice. If you’re looking for a more challenging career in the law field, becoming an attorney is a great option. Project Management Jobs in Tulsa, Oklahoma: A Comprehensive Guide Tulsa, Oklahoma, is a thriving city with a diverse economy that offers ample opportunities for professionals in various fields. One of the most sought-after careers in Tulsa is project management. Project management professionals are in high demand in Tulsa, as many companies in the city rely on them to manage their projects effectively and efficiently. If you're interested in pursuing a career in project management in Tulsa, this guide provides a comprehensive overview of the job market, the skills required, and the career prospects. Overview of Project Management Jobs in Tulsa Tulsa is home to many large and small companies that require project management professionals to ensure the success of their projects. These companies operate in various sectors, including energy, construction, healthcare, finance, and technology. Some of the top employers of project managers in Tulsa include Williams, ONEOK, Saint Francis Health System, and the University of Tulsa.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), the average annual wage for a project manager in Tulsa is $92,830. The demand for project managers in Tulsa is expected to grow by 7.4% over the next decade, which is higher than the national average of 5%. Skills Required for Project Management Jobs in Tulsa To succeed in a project management career in Tulsa, you need to have a combination of technical, interpersonal, and organizational skills. Some of the essential skills required for project management jobs in Tulsa include: 1. Leadership: Project managers are responsible for leading teams and ensuring that everyone is working towards the same goals. Therefore, strong leadership skills are essential. 2. Communication: Project managers need to communicate effectively with stakeholders, team members, and clients. They need to be able to convey complex information in a clear and concise manner. 3. Time management: Project managers must be able to manage their time effectively to ensure that projects are completed on time and within budget. 4. Risk management: Project managers need to be able to identify potential risks and develop strategies to mitigate them. 5. Technical skills: Project managers must have a good understanding of the technical aspects of the projects they are managing. They should be familiar with project management tools and software. Career Prospects for Project Managers in Tulsa Project management is a growing field in Tulsa, and there are many opportunities for professionals to advance in their careers. Some of the career paths for project managers in Tulsa include: 1. Project Manager: This is the most common career path for project management professionals. Project managers are responsible for planning, executing, and closing projects. 2. Program Manager: Program managers oversee multiple projects and ensure that they are aligned with the organization's strategic objectives. 3. Portfolio Manager: Portfolio managers oversee a collection of projects and programs and ensure that they are aligned with the organization's overall goals. 4. Project Management Office (PMO) Manager: PMO Managers are responsible for managing the project management office and ensuring that project management standards and best practices are followed. 5. Agile Project Manager: Agile project managers use agile methodologies to plan and execute projects. They work closely with cross-functional teams to deliver projects in an iterative and incremental manner. Conclusion Project management is a rewarding and challenging career path that offers many opportunities for growth and advancement. Tulsa, Oklahoma, is a great place to start or advance your career in project management. With its diverse economy and growing demand for project management professionals, Tulsa offers a wealth of opportunities for those who have the right skills and qualifications. Whether you're just starting your career or looking to take it to the next level, there are many project management jobs in Tulsa waiting for you.

Outsourcing American Jobs: The Pros and Cons The outsourcing of jobs from the United States to other countries has been a controversial topic for many years. Some view it as a necessary step for businesses to remain competitive in the global marketplace, while others see it as a betrayal of American workers. In this essay, we will explore the pros and cons of outsourcing American jobs. Pros of Outsourcing American Jobs 1. Cost Savings One of the main reasons why businesses outsource jobs to other countries is to save money. By outsourcing certain tasks to countries where labor is cheaper, businesses can reduce their operating costs and increase their profit margins. This is especially true for labor-intensive industries such as manufacturing and customer service. 2. Access to Skilled Labor Another advantage of outsourcing is that businesses can gain access to highly skilled workers in other countries who may not be available in the United States. For example, India is known for its highly skilled workforce in the IT sector, and many American companies have outsourced their IT operations to India to take advantage of this expertise. 3. Increased Efficiency Outsourcing certain tasks can also help businesses become more efficient. By outsourcing non-core functions such as accounting and payroll, companies can focus on their core competencies and improve their overall productivity. 4. Global Presence Outsourcing jobs to other countries can also help businesses establish a global presence. By working with companies in other countries, businesses can gain a better understanding of international markets and expand their customer base. Cons of Outsourcing American Jobs 1. Job Losses The biggest disadvantage of outsourcing American jobs is the loss of jobs for American workers. When companies outsource jobs to other countries, American workers are often laid off, which can lead to economic hardship for individuals and communities. 2. Lower Quality Work Another downside of outsourcing is that the quality of work may suffer. When jobs are outsourced to countries where labor is cheaper, the workers may not be as skilled or experienced as American workers, which can lead to lower quality work. 3. Language and Cultural Barriers Outsourcing to other countries can also create language and cultural barriers. When businesses work with workers in other countries, communication can be difficult, which can lead to misunderstandings and mistakes. 4. Data Security Risks Outsourcing certain tasks such as IT and customer service can also create data security risks. When sensitive data is shared with workers in other countries, there is a risk of data breaches and cyberattacks. Conclusion The outsourcing of American jobs is a complex issue with both pros and cons. While outsourcing can help businesses save money, access skilled labor, and become more efficient, it can also lead to job losses, lower quality work, language and cultural barriers, and data security risks. Ultimately, businesses must weigh the benefits and risks of outsourcing and make decisions that are in the best interests of their companies and their employees.
